Why may EENY be the right solution?
"Eeny" is the start of a popular counting-out rhyme that is commonly used to choose who will be "it" in a game. The full rhyme goes "Eeny, meeny, miny, moe, catch a tiger by the toe." Therefore, "Eeny" is a fitting answer for the clue.
